What Netflix’s Exit from Warner Bros Means for Your Career

Netflix's decision to exit the Warner Bros. takeover battle has significant implications for professionals in the media industry. Discover what this means for your career and future opportunities.

Netflix’s recent decision to withdraw from the Warner Bros. takeover battle has sent ripples through the media landscape. This move, described as a ‘win for everyone,’ has significant implications for professionals in the streaming and entertainment sectors. As Paramount positions itself to acquire Warner Bros, the dynamics of content creation, distribution, and competition are shifting rapidly. For those in the media industry, understanding these changes is crucial.

As of February 27, 2026, Netflix’s shares surged by 8.5% following the announcement of their exit. The streaming giant chose to prioritize its core business over a potentially costly acquisition, which underscores a critical lesson for professionals: adaptability and strategic decision-making are key in an ever-evolving industry.

The implications of this decision extend beyond stock prices. With Paramount’s bid for Warner Bros gaining momentum, professionals need to consider how these corporate maneuvers will shape job opportunities and industry standards.

Why Netflix’s Withdrawal Matters for Media Professionals

Netflix’s exit from the Warner Bros. deal clears the way for Paramount to advance its $111 billion bid. This shift not only alters the competitive landscape of streaming services but also signals a change in how companies approach acquisitions in the media sector. The decision reflects a broader trend where companies are re-evaluating their growth strategies amidst economic uncertainties.

According to a recent report, Paramount’s acquisition could significantly increase its market share in the streaming sector, potentially making it a direct competitor to Netflix and other leading platforms. This merger would combine valuable intellectual properties, including franchises like Harry Potter and Game of Thrones, which could redefine content offerings across platforms.

The Impact on Job Opportunities in Streaming Services

The fallout from Netflix’s decision is likely to create both challenges and opportunities for media professionals. As Paramount moves forward with its acquisition, there will be a need for talent to manage the integration of Warner Bros’ assets. This could lead to a surge in job openings in various areas, including:

  • Content Development: Professionals skilled in creating compelling narratives will be in high demand as Paramount seeks to leverage its new intellectual properties.
  • Marketing and Distribution: With increased competition, there will be a greater need for innovative marketing strategies that can effectively reach audiences.
  • Technology and Data Analytics: As streaming services rely heavily on data to drive decisions, professionals with expertise in data analysis will be essential for optimizing viewer engagement.

Moreover, as companies like Paramount and Netflix refine their strategies, the skills that were once considered essential may shift. For instance, while traditional media experience was highly valued in the past, there may now be a greater emphasis on digital marketing and analytics capabilities. Professionals who can adapt to these changes will be better positioned to thrive.

Preparing for the Evolving Media Landscape

As a media professional, it’s crucial to stay ahead of industry trends and continuously develop your skill set. Here are some actionable steps you can take:

  • Upskill in Digital Marketing: Consider enrolling in online courses focused on digital marketing strategies and analytics tools.
  • Network within the Industry: Attend industry events and webinars to connect with peers and leaders in the field. Building a strong network can open doors to new opportunities.
  • Stay Informed: Follow industry news closely, particularly developments related to mergers and acquisitions, as these can signal shifts in job availability and required skills.

However, experts caution that while consolidation may create opportunities, it could also lead to job losses in overlapping functions as companies streamline their operations. According to a report by Variety, the media landscape is becoming increasingly volatile, and professionals must be prepared for potential layoffs or restructuring within their organizations.

The Future of Media Consolidation and Job Markets

Looking ahead, the media industry is likely to continue evolving rapidly. As companies seek to enhance their competitive edge, we may see further consolidation among major players. This could lead to a more centralized media landscape, with fewer companies controlling a larger share of the market.
